Yellow tinted edges.150 pp 12mo. This is the story of Clint Eastwood, the man, one of the most complex and fascinating figures in movieland. It's the story of his films, from the bit parts in Hollywood, the TV years with Rawhide, the Italian Westerns, to the major movies made by his own company. It's the story of the making of a star and legend, and how Eastwood used that growth to develop not only as a performer but as a director as well. A clean very presentable copy.
